This paper introduces Cottonscope, a new instrument for the measurement of cotton maturity based on the Siromat instrument developed by CSIRO from Geelong Australia. There have been several papers presented on Siromat at previous conferences. The instrument combines the technology of Siromat and the OFDA instrument.

OFDA (Optical based fibre diameter analyser, www.ofda.com) is the most common instrument worldwide for the measurement of animal fibre diameter (wool, cashmere, alpaca etc). Measurement time for 2000 fibres is less than 30 seconds.

The maturity measurement derives from the repeatable colour measurement of fibre snippets dispersed on a glass slide. The principle is an automation of ASTM 1442.
